PURPOSE: The purpose of this RFI is to gather information for the U.S. Office of Special Counsel regarding availability and price of specific expert legal services. 3. BACKGROUND: The U.S. Office of Special Counsel is a small independent executive branch agency that investigates claims of prohibited personnel practices, Hatch Act Violations, USERRA violations, and other violations of the merit system in the federal government. 4. TIMEFRAMES: For planning purposes, this RFI is being conducted in support of an acquisition decision in the July/August 2007 timeframe. 5. CAPABILITIES: Constitutional Law Expert OSC is seeking to gather information regarding availability and hourly rates of experts in the field of Constitutional Law. OSC has interest in contracting with one of the foremost experts in the country in the field of constitutional law. The expert should be recognized nationally or internationally as a top expert. Recognition of this level of expertise could be established, for example, through such things as: ?P Experience with preparing successful briefs for use in Supreme Court cases related to constitutional law. ?P Being the author of prominent text books on constitutional law. ?P Providing expertise and knowledge to foreign nations seeking advice and assistance with constitutional issues and developments of new constitutions. ?P Being ranked by national associations or media as one of the top experts in the field. The expert will provide advisory services, and may draft and/or review legal work products. These work products will likely be focused in certain complex areas of constitutional law, to include (not exclusively) the following: ?P executive privilege ?P jurisdictional issues ?P interplay of presidential powers vs. statutes and authority of independent executive branch agencies 6.
